Davis (Gloria R.) Middle School serves 164 students in grades 7-9.
The student-teacher ratio of 9:1 was lower than the California state level of 21:1.

<麻豆果冻传媒 class='so-dt-title' id='faq'>Frequently Asked Questions麻豆果冻传媒> How many students attend Davis (Gloria R.) Middle School?
164 students attend Davis (Gloria R.) Middle School.
What is the racial composition of the student body?
72% of Davis (Gloria R.) Middle School students are Black, 21% of students are Asian, 4% of students are American Indian, and 3% of students are Hispanic.
What is the student-teacher ratio of Davis (Gloria R.) Middle School?
Davis (Gloria R.) Middle School has a student ration of 9:1, which is lower than the California state average of 21:1.
What grades does Davis (Gloria R.) Middle School offer ?
Davis (Gloria R.) Middle School offers enrollment in grades 7-9
What school district is Davis (Gloria R.) Middle School part of?
Davis (Gloria R.) Middle School is part of San Francisco Unified School District.
